Recap
Possibly our last billiards game for a while – so nice to go out on a win
Jim again set the tone with a very assured 5890 against Nick who had no answer against Nenecupper’s rich vein of form
Damo and Mick went to and fro until Damo stepped in with a decent break to secure the leg and another Master’s premier league outing (if it happens?)
Aidan started like a train – playing really, positively and racking up a great opening break of 2.5k – a well deserved “player of the match” was already a possibility. Chas just couldn’t get the break back despite his best efforts. Aidan went on to secure the leg and a unanimous vote for “player of the match”
Stew v Mick saw a couple of canny players have a few chances with Mick looking like he had nicked it towards the end. Disaster struck as he knocked a pin over giving Stew a last chance for victory. Our “possibly 3rd best player” stepped up to secure the leg
When Martin missed, early on, in the 5th leg it was always going to be an uphill battle. Andy continued his recent upturn in form to hit another 10k+ score
A great night played with a team that has real potential to rattle a few cages next year
